Job Title: Specialist Data Engineering

Full-time role

Working Hours: Full-time 35 hours per week

Salary: £64,575

Location: London Docklands (Hybrid). Our permanent hybrid policy sees us all working at least four days across a fortnight in the office.

The Financial Ombudsman Service has been resolving customer complaints since 2001. Our service is free for consumers to use and over 1 million people contact us every year.

The last few years have seen the Financial Ombudsman Service embark on an organisation-wide transformation journey. With the customer at the heart of everything we do, we have already delivered significant improvements in the service we offer and 2026 will see us continue with our ambitious transformation agenda.

This year, we created our new Chief Data Office as part of redefining our data strategy across the organisation. With data playing an increasingly vital role in our transformation journey, the CDO is shaping a modern, cloud-first data landscape that supports innovation, enhances decision-making, and strengthens our customer-centric approach. It’s an exciting time to be part of the Data team at the Financial Ombudsman Service

Key Responsibilities:

  • Designing and maintaining ETL/ELT pipelines using Azure Data Factory, Synapse and Databricks.
  • Collaborating with data modellers, analysts, and governance leads to ensure data quality and usability.
  • Contribute to the design, implementation and maintenance of large-scale enterprise data platform solutions, ensuring quality, scalability, reliability and performance.
  • Collaborating with the team, overseeing the ongoing operational support of the data platform services and processes.
  • Ensuring the team’s SLA obligations for data delivery, and reliability are met, and that incidents and requests are managed appropriately.
  • Partner with Data Engineer Lead in forums and working groups with business stakeholders and cross-functional teams in collecting functional and non-functional requirements, considering technical environments, business constraints and wider enterprise organisation.
  • Collaboration and overseeing development and testing of data service improvements with cross-functional teams in all environments, balancing business priorities with technical improvements and managing technical debt.
  • Overseeing code promotion process across the data platform solutions and environments, adhering to Service Management change process.
  • Support delivery of data models in partnership with stakeholders, ensuring data quality and integrity.
  • Partner closely with IT application and infrastructure teams in promoting; strong alignment to security and compliance, continual integration with source systems and efficient infrastructure resource management.
  • Contribute to making complex decisions regarding data design and implementation, with significant impact on data quality and business intelligence outcomes.
  • Oversee the creation and maintenance of technical documentation and knowledge sharing including data flow/mappings, data dictionary, ERD related to the data solutions.

Minimum Criteria:

  • Building scalable data pipelines, utilising Azure Data Factory, Synapse and Databricks to build and maintain robust data pipelines that process and transform data efficiently.
  • Experience with large data migration (essential)
  • Designing data models: Creating and optimising data models, writing complex SQL and Python queries.
  • Hands on experience with Spark and RESTFul APIs
  • Solid knowledge of data warehouse and Delta Lakehouse technologies.
  • Working with Microsoft Azure and SQL technologies such as Azure Synapse Analytics, Azure Data Factory, Azure storage, Azure SQL and SQL Server.
  • Implementing CI/CD pipelines for data solutions
  • Collaborating cross-functionally, working with data analysts, and business stakeholders to deliver comprehensive data solutions.
  • Experience in executing projects, setting targets, planning work, and ensuring timely delivery of projects.
  • Earning certifications, holding Azure certification such as Azure Data Engineer Associate or similar is highly desirable.
  • Identifying improvements: Continuously improving processes to enhance the efficiency and effectiveness of data operations.
  • Experience with SAP Data Services (desirable)
